Germany’s industrial production fell by 3.9pc in January on an annual basis and by 2.5pc from December 2020, according to the Federal Statistical Office (Destatis).
Excluding the energy sector, Germany’s production dropped by 0.5pc in January from December 2020, Destatis reported. Capital goods production dropped by 0.8pc while consumer goods production decreased by 3pc. However, intermediate goods output was up by 0.7pc in January this year from the previous month. Production in the construction sector saw a 12.2pc fall during this period.
Compared to February last year, just before the COVID-19 pandemic broke out, industrial production was short by 4.2pc.
